Sat Nov 02 04:12:09 UTC 2024: ## BJP Leader Devender Singh Rana Passes Away at 59
**Jammu, November 1, 2024:** Devender Singh Rana, a prominent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) leader and recently elected MLA from Nagrota, passed away on Thursday night at a private hospital in Faridabad, Haryana. He was 59.
Rana, who had been unwell for some time, is survived by his wife, two daughters, and a son. His brother, Union Minister Jitendra Singh, described his passing as an “irreparable and painful loss.”
Prime Minister Narendra Modi expressed his condolences on X, praising Rana as a “veteran leader” who worked diligently for Jammu and Kashmir’s progress.
J&K Chief Minister Omar Abdullah, a former political ally of Rana, attended the funeral in Jammu. He expressed his sorrow on X, recalling their shared experiences and work.
Leaders across the political spectrum, including Mehbooba Mufti of the PDP, Altaf Bukhari of the Apni Party, Sajad Lone of the Peoples Conference, Ghulam Nabi Azad, and former Governor N.N. Vohra, also offered their condolences.
